How much do work from home pega developer j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 9, 2026, the average hourly pay for work from home pega developer in the United States is $62.61,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$54.09 and $70.91 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a work from home Pega developer?

A Work From Home Pega Developer is a software professional who designs, builds, and maintains applications using Pega, a popular business process management and automation platform. These developers work remotely, collaborating with teams and clients online to deliver solutions that streamline business processes. Their responsibilities often include system design, configuration, integration, and troubleshooting Pega applications, all from a home office environment. The remote aspect allows for flexibility while still contributing to enterprise-level digital transformation projects.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a work from home Pega developer?

To thrive as a Work From Home Pega Developer, you need strong skills in Pega application development, process modeling, and a solid understanding of business process management, usually backed by a degree in computer science or a related field. Familiarity with Pega Platform, PRPC, Agile methodologies, and certifications like Pega Certified System Architect (PCSA) are typically required. Excellent communication, self-motivation, and problem-solving abilities are vital soft skills for collaborating remotely and delivering solutions. These competencies ensure effective, independent project delivery and high-quality, scalable Pega solutions for clients.

How does a work from home Pega developer typically collaborate with team members and stakeholders remotely?

As a remote Pega Developer, collaboration is primarily managed through digital communication tools such as video conferencing, instant messaging, and project management platforms. You'll regularly participate in virtual stand-ups, sprint planning meetings, and code reviews to ensure alignment with business requirements and team objectives. Close coordination with business analysts, QA testers, and other developers is essential for troubleshooting, implementing changes, and deploying solutions. Maintaining clear documentation and proactively communicating progress and challenges help ensure smooth workflow and project success in a remote setting.

Are work from home Pega developers in demand?

Work from home Pega developers are in demand due to the increasing adoption of Pega platform solutions across industries. Companies seek skilled developers with expertise in Pega systems, business process management, and related tools, making remote opportunities widely available for qualified professionals.

How much do work from home Pega developers make?

Work from home Pega developers typically earn between $80,000 and $130,000 annually, depending on experience, certifications, and location. Senior developers with advanced skills and certifications can earn higher salaries, especially when working remotely for larger organizations or consulting firms.

PEGA RPA--Senior Application Development Engineer 

Contract Duration: Through December 31, 2026 (with potential for extension or conversion)

Location: Remote – Anywhere in the United States

Work Schedule: Monday–Friday, 8:00 AM–5:00 PM (No overtime anticipated)

Job Summary

We are seeking a Senior Application Development Engineer with strong PEGA RPA experience to join an Agile development team supporting a large-scale enterprise automation initiative. In this role, you will design, develop, test, and deploy robotic process automation (RPA) solutions while collaborating with developers, business analysts, architects, and other stakeholders. This is an excellent opportunity to contribute to a high-impact automation project with potential for long-term work beyond the initial engagement.

Key Responsibilities
  • Design, develop, and maintain enterprise-grade PEGA RPA solutions.

  • Participate in all Agile Scrum ceremonies, including daily stand-ups, sprint planning, backlog refinement, sprint reviews, and retrospectives.

  • Collaborate with developers, architects, and business stakeholders to deliver application enhancements.

  • Write clean, maintainable, and high-quality code following established coding standards.

  • Perform software testing, deployment, and production support activities.

  • Troubleshoot application issues and resolve defects in a timely manner.

  • Participate in peer code reviews and knowledge-sharing sessions.

  • Provide regular status updates and work collaboratively to remove project impediments.

  • Support continuous improvement initiatives focused on code quality and development best practices.

Top Required Skills
  1. 5+ years of hands-on PEGA RPA development experience (Required)

  2. Strong experience working within Agile/Scrum environments and the Software Development Life Cycle (SDLC)

  3. Experience with software testing, production deployments, and application support

Preferred Skills
  • Experience with Git or Azure DevOps version control

  • Jira and/or Azure DevOps work management tools

  • Production support and troubleshooting

  • Enterprise application environment management

  • Knowledge of software architecture and programming best practices

  • Experience reviewing code quality and development standards

  • Experience collaborating with or guiding third-party development teams

  • SAFe (Scaled Agile Framework) certification or experience

Education Requirements
  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Engineering, Information Technology, Mathematics, or a related technical field, or equivalent professional experience.
